EA Sports is releasing its highly anticipated College Football 26 on July 10th, but there are already leaks out there with insider information, including player ratings. Recently, TeamCrafters.net published the Wisconsin player rankings based on leaks. There is currently only one player on the Badgers team that has a 90 or higher rating, and that is defensive back Ricardo Hallman at 90.
The 5 best Wisconsin players on College Football 26
1. DB - Ricardo Hallman - 90 overall
2. RT - Riley Mahlman - 89 overall
3. SS - Preston Zachman - 88 overall
4. CB - Nyzier Fourqurean - 87 overall
5. FS - Austin Brown - 86 overall
The list isn't overly surprising, as many of the standouts are now primed for a bigger year next season. It is surprising that there isn't one transfer included in the top players, even though Luke Fickell worked to restock the transfer portal. Lance Mason is the highest-rated transfer at 82.
Wisconsin's starting quarterback, Billy Edwards Jr., has an 81 rating, an 83 speed rating, and the highest-rated skills are toughness, stamina, and injury. This is, in some ways, good news for the Badgers, as injury haunted Wisconsin last season. Maybe that injury rating will prove true this season, and he can stay healthy all of 2025.
According to EA Sports, Wisconsin's best position group is its running back depth, with an overall score of 81. The safeties are next, rated 78. After that, it's pretty rough.
Obviously, these rankings could still change before the actual release, and the website TeamCrafters, which provided the leak, is quick to point that fact out. There are always some changes before the release and then throughout the season as players perform better or worse than their projected rankings for video game users who continue to update the game.
